[双穴吸虫属和泰勒吸虫属(双穴科,双穴亚目)吸虫的染色体结构及其分类学意义]

[Chromosomal apparatus of trematodes of the general Diplostomum and Tylodelphys (Strigeidida, Diplostomatidae) and its taxonomic significance].

作者信息

Romanenko L N, Shigin A A

出版信息

Parazitologiia. 1977 Nov-Dec;11(6):530-6.

PMID:593722
Abstract

The chromosomal apparatus of three species of trematodes of Diplostomum (D. spathaceum, D. indistinctum, D. mergi) and one species Tylodelphys (T. clavata) is described. It has been suggested that karyological investigations can be used for taxonomic purposes. The opinion has been expressed that the number of chromosomes in the karyotype of these trematodes plays no taxonomic role. Of great taxonomic significance are the size and morphology of chromosomes. Differences in karyotypes of trematodes belonging to different species and genera were revealed by these characters. The absence of close dependence between morphology of adult and specific peculiarities of karyotypes in species of the same genus enables in some cases the use of chromosomal apparatus as a most reliable criterion for a differentiation of close species.

摘要

描述了双口吸虫属的三种吸虫(剑状双口吸虫、模糊双口吸虫、麦氏双口吸虫)和一种泰勒吸虫(棒状泰勒吸虫)的染色体结构。有人认为核型研究可用于分类目的。有人认为这些吸虫核型中的染色体数目不具有分类学作用。染色体的大小和形态具有重要的分类学意义。通过这些特征揭示了不同属吸虫核型的差异。同一属物种成虫形态与核型特异性特征之间不存在紧密相关性,这使得在某些情况下可以将染色体结构作为区分近缘物种的最可靠标准。
